A housing management organization in Nottingham is seeking a Collections Officer, also known as a Customer Accounts Advisor. This full-time role involves managing accounts in arrears, engaging with customers through various communication channels, and negotiating payment arrangements.

Ideal candidates will have:

  • Strong collections experience
  • Excellent communication skills
  • The ability to work independently

The position also offers hybrid working options, allowing flexibility in work locations.

How to prepare for a job interview at Inside Housing Management

✨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of a Collections Officer. Brush up on your knowledge of housing management and collections processes. Familiarise yourself with common challenges in managing accounts in arrears, as this will show your potential employer that you're serious about the position.

✨Show Off Your Communication Skills

Since excellent communication is key for this role, prepare to demonstrate your skills during the interview. Think of examples where you've successfully engaged with customers or negotiated payment arrangements. Practising these scenarios can help you articulate your experience clearly and confidently.

✨Be Ready for Role-Play

Expect some role-play scenarios during the interview. This could involve negotiating a payment plan with a 'customer'. Practise how you would handle difficult conversations and showcase your empathetic approach. Remember, they want to see how you would interact in real-life situations!

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ions to ask at the end of your interview. Inquire about the team dynamics, the tools they use for managing accounts, or how they measure success in the role.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the company culture aligns with your values.
